Hi all,

Had the roof stop working on me last week while trying to put it down using the switch in the car. Windows went down, back window went up, trunk unlocked, then nothing. Couldn’t see anything obvious like chafing of wires etc. Was not able to open the trunk lid so I slowly pulled the lid back enough to reach the luggage lid and check for proper seating. Seemed fine. I then pulled the emergency lid release. Poked around and did not see anything obvious. No hydraulic leaks and pump looked fine. No rust. Drove it to the dealer at slow speed.

Dealer says it’s maybe a micro switch. They change that out and are now telling me it’s a hall sensor and the hydro pump. I nearly passed out when they quoted me $4k for the pump unit part. They said the pump seems to be hydro locked. Possibly from me pulling up the trunk. They were not able to release the pressure on one side. This sounds suspicious to me. I could use some expert advice from someone who knows their way around these units. I’m a DIYer, but but I don’t have any data on these pumps. I see lots of hex screws, but don’t know what they do. I feel like it should be possible to drain out all the fluid and unlock it. I guess it could be a solinoid failure. I see three solidnoids on it. Are they testable and replaceable?

I also need a recommendation on a diagnosis tool for BMWs as my scanner is not able to read much. Amy help would be appreciated.

The pump wont be hydrolocked.I have moved roof's manually to access the rear mech and hinges on a few occasions.

I have done a few Z4 roof problems and 9 times out of 10 its the microswitch on the hinges in the boot.

Diag wise.... Many people use carly,its a cheap enough thing to use. We use GT1 and Autel Maxisys 908,but they are more pro user stuff.

I would have a good search around this forum before dashing off and paying extortion money to have it fixed.
I bought a Foxwell NT520 pro reader http://www.foxwelltool.co.uk/wholesale/ ... gL7AvD_BwE
It allows you to see things switching in real time.
It also said there were several microswitch faults, when in fact there were non.
I ended up replacing the two salmon coloured relays next to the pump and all worked fine after.
I have taken some hall switches apart and cannot see how they would fail.
But more likely a connector or wire problem.
